I changed eqv? in dynamic.scm to be macro-expanded the way I  
suggested in the previous e-mail.  It didn't make a whole lot of  
difference (note the compile time on my 2.something GHz opteron  
server; this is getting obscene).

Old way:

euler-83% ./bench gambit dynamic

Testing dynamic under Gambit-C-r5rs
Compiling...
144.25user 5.18system 2:30.64elapsed 99%CPU (0avgtext+0avgdata  
0maxresident)k
0inputs+0outputs (0major+1214690minor)pagefaults 0swaps
Running...

(time (run-bench name count ok? run))
     1315 ms real time
     1265 ms cpu time (1231 user, 34 system)
     33 collections accounting for 288 ms real time (265 user, 7 system)
     245641224 bytes allocated
     8696 minor faults
     no major faults


New way:

euler-81% ./bench gambit dynamic

Testing dynamic under Gambit-C-r5rs
Compiling...
146.31user 5.43system 2:35.02elapsed 97%CPU (0avgtext+0avgdata  
0maxresident)k
0inputs+0outputs (0major+1220725minor)pagefaults 0swaps
Running...

(time (run-bench name count ok? run))
     1231 ms real time
     1190 ms cpu time (1160 user, 30 system)
     33 collections accounting for 289 ms real time (270 user, 6 system)
     245641224 bytes allocated
     8696 minor faults
     no major faults
